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
1. "There lived a man so long ago his memories but __________."

Answer: faint

"There lived a man so long ago his memories but faint,
Was not admired, did not inspire, like president or saint."
This is the very first line of the song, sung by the three scallions and Phil, the stalk of celery from Toledo.
2. "But people came from far and near with their afflicted _________."

Answer: pets

"But people came from far and near with their afflicted pets,
For a special cure, they knew for sure, wouldn't come from other vets."
After this line, the doctor, played by Larry, begins his "treatment" for the penguin.
3. "This is a song for your poor sick penguin. He's got a fever and his ______are blue."

Answer: toes

"This is a song for your poor sick penguin,
He's got a fever and his toes are blue,
But if I sing to your poor sick penguin,
He will feel better in a day or two."
The penguin then sneezes the thermometer into the doctor's eye.
4. "Some would stand in silence while some just scratched their scalps, for the _________ ways of the Yodeling Veterinarian of the Alps."

Answer: curious

"No skeptic could explain just how nor could what oft rebut,
The wondrous deeds that went on in that little alpine hut.
Some would stand in silence, while some just scratched their scalps,
For the curious ways of the yodeling veterinarian of the Alps."
This line is sung twice throughout the song, once here, and once at the end of the song.
5. "This is a song for your pregnant kitty; she's looking nauseous and a _________ past due."

Answer: week

"This is a song for your pregnant kitty,
She's looking nauseous and a week past due.
But if I sing to your pregnant kitty,
She will feel better in a day or two."
After Larry finished the yodel to the cat, she sounded like she needed to cough up a hairball.
6. "Jump in your car, drive into the city, buy a jug of milk for your nauseated _________."

Answer: kitty

"Jump in your car, drive into the city,
Buy a jug of milk for your nauseated kitty."
Pa Grape, the nurse, says this to the cat's owner after the doctor finished yodeling to the cat.
7. "The practice grew, their profits flew, until one fateful day, when the nurse who did assist the doc asked for a raise in ________."

Answer: pay

"The practice grew, their profits flew, until one fateful day,
When the nurse who did assist the doc asked for a raise in pay.
The doctor pondered this awhile, sat back and scratched his scalp,
Then said "No way, Jose," to the nurse of the yodeling veterinarian of the Alps!"
This was Larry's downfall when he didn't give Pa a raise, because Pa didn't tell the owners of the pets what they needed, and Larry couldn't just heal the animals by yodeling to them.
8. "Good news on the kitty doc, ________ kittens, named one after you."

Answer: six

Pa Grape, who plays the nurse, told the doctor, played by Larry, that the pregnant kitty had just had six kittens, and that the owner had named one of them after the doctor.
9. "This is a song for your bear-trapped teddy, he looks uncomfy, think ________ be too!"

Answer: I'd

"This is a song for your bear-trapped teddy,
He looks uncomfy, think I'd be too!
But if I sing to your bear-trapped teddy,
He will feel better in a day or two."
After Larry finishes his yodel to the bear, Pa Grape says, "Oh yeah, that'll work, he's good." Then the bear roars and goes after Larry.
10. "Now the moral of our story is the point we hope we've made. When you go a little ________ better keep your nurse well paid."

Answer: loopy

"Now the moral of our story is the point we hope we've made.
When you go a little loopy better keep your nurse well paid.
Some would stand in silence while some just scratched their scalps,
For the curious ways of the yodeling veterinarian of the Alps!"
